PHP基础:高效实现查询结果Excel导出
需积分: 9 72 浏览量
更新于2024-09-12
收藏 5KB TXT 举报
在PHP基础教程中,我们将探讨如何将查询结果有效地保存到Excel文件,这是一个实用且常见的需求,尤其是在数据处理和报表生成时。本篇内容主要关注于一个名为"ѯ浽Excel"的示例代码,该代码片段展示了如何在HTML页面中结合PHP与JavaScript来实现这一功能。
首先,让我们看下index.php文件的结构。它采用XHTML1.0规范,定义了文档类型和字符编码。HTML头部包含了元数据,如页面标题、CSS样式表链接以及一个用于检查输入是否为空的JavaScript函数`chkinput()`,确保必填字段`sno`不为空。
HTML表格布局清晰,分为三个层次,分别设置了顶部图片、中间的导航区域和底部操作区域。中间区域的表格嵌套在另一个表格中,提供了一个包含表单的表格,表单的`method`属性设置为`post`,`action`指向了自身,即`index.php`,并在提交时调用`re`函数,可能是为了进一步处理表单数据。
JavaScript函数`chkinput(form)`的作用是验证`sno`字段是否为空。如果为空,会弹出警告并阻止表单提交。这体现了良好的用户体验和数据验证实践。
接着,表单元素`<form>`包括`sno`字段,用户可能需要输入学号等信息。表单提交后,这些输入将被发送到同一页面进行进一步处理,例如执行SQL查询获取数据。
关键知识点:
1. **PHP与HTML结合**:这段代码展示了如何在PHP页面中嵌套HTML表单,使得用户可以交互并提交数据。
2. **数据验证**:通过JavaScript函数对用户输入进行验证,确保数据的完整性。
3. **查询操作**:虽然代码没有直接显示查询语句,但可以推测后续步骤会涉及使用PHP执行SQL查询,并获取数据库中的数据。
4. **数据导出到Excel**:虽然这部分代码未明确展示如何生成Excel文件,但可以预期这部分会在服务器端(可能使用PHPExcel或类似库)处理查询结果,然后以Excel格式下载或导出。
5. **文件操作**:涉及到将数据写入Excel文件,包括创建新的Excel工作簿、添加工作表、写入数据行等操作。
总结来说,这个示例提供了将用户提交的表单数据与数据库查询结合,通过PHP将查询结果转化为Excel文件的基础框架。深入学习这部分内容,可以帮助开发者更好地理解如何在PHP环境中处理数据并生成报告。
135 浏览量
2018-05-11 上传
点击了解资源详情
2011-02-11 上传
2019-07-31 上传
2012-03-10 上传
2016-08-17 上传
2015-05-26 上传
2012-12-20 上传
shenshenjp
- 粉丝: 48
- 资源: 526
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率